Mobile agent computing pdf

Basically, there are three application domains do need mobile agent. Mobile computing technology applications and service creation. Pdf in the last decade, mobile and portable devices have gained popularity in a rapid pace. Mcc offers new kinds of services and facilities for patients and caregivers. Mobile agent, multiparty collaborative computing, privacy, steganography, ubiquitous computing. Mobile agents in networking and distributed computing. One of the strengths of mobile agent computing is the possibility of moving complex processing functions to the location where huge amounts of data are to be processed. Definition properties of mobile agent pros and cons life cycle of mobile agent applications types mobile agents system 2 3. Pdf system software support for mobileagent computing.

Managing location information of mobile agents mas is an important issue in ma based mobile computing systems. The convergence of wireless computational models with mobile agent technologies. In computer science, a software agent is a computer program that acts for a user or other program in a relationship of agency, which derives from the latin agere to do. Intelligent mobile agents for heterogeneous devices in. The main advantages of mobile agent computing as listed by chess et al. Therefore, they are a natural view of a distributed system. This tutorial will give an overview of mobile computing and then it. Mobile computing roger wattenhofer summer 2004 distributed computing group chapter 1 introduction. A jvm java virtual machine and a map mobile agent place is installed on every virtual machine in the ccr cloud computing region, a ccsp or an administrative domain in one ccsp, this process can be done automatically.

Mobile agentsthe new paradigm in computing citeseerx. At this point, most of the theoretical research on mobile agents ignores these properties and they will not be discussed below. It provides two unique two mechanisms for dynamically organizing mo. But active applications can only move to a local cluster of computers. The book focuses on mobile agents, which are computer programs that can autonomously migrate between network sites. A mobile agent system for organizing multiple mobile agents is presented. A mobile agent is a program that, once it is launched by a user, can travel from node to node autonomously, and can continue to function even if the user is disconnected from the network. Accordingly, we assume that mcc is likely to be of the heart of healthcare transformation. An enhanced healthcare system in mobile cloud computing. The mobile clients are differentiated into two types depending upon their capacity and the corresponding mobile agent is chosen for the traversal. A mobi le agent based trust model for cloud computing priyank singh hada central university of rajasthan, kishangarh ranjita singh central university of rajasthan, kishangarh mukul manmohan meghwal central university of rajasthan, kishangarh abstract in cloud computing infrastructure, usually cloud user has to rely.

Definition properties of mobile agent pros and cons life cycle of mobile agent applications types mobile agents system 2. An agent is an independent software program which runs on behalf of a network user. One is dataintensive applications where the data is remotely located, is owned by the remote service provider, and the. Researchers must provide a clear evolutionary path from current systems to mobile agent systems. View academics in mobile agent computing on academia. The mobile communication in this case, refers to the infrastructure put in. We propose a model we call the agentserver model, which we will show is structurally superior to. Mobile agent is an agent that migrates from machine to machine in a heterogeneous network at times of its own choosing. Term paper anitha chennamaneni abstract mobile agent paradigm is an emerging and exciting paradigm for mobile computing applications.

Mobile agent technology offers a new computing paradigm in which a software agent can suspend its execution on a host computer, transfer itself to another. Abstract mobile agent technology has been promoted as an emerging technology that makes it much easier to design, implement, and maintain distributed systems, including cloud comput. Mobile agent is a type of software system which acts intelligently on ones behalf with the. However, in contrast to the remote evaluation and code on demand programming paradigms, mobile agents are active in that they can choose to migrate between computers at any time during their execution. Chapter 1 overview of mobile ip mobile ip administration. This paper presents a possible mobile agent based architecture to effectively harness the power of the world wide web as a global computing platform. Mobile agents are the pieces of codes that are used to store data and are independent in nature i. Oct 05, 2001 mobile ip uses a strong authentication scheme for security purposes.

The case for mobileagent computing for defense applications. A mobile agent, namely, is a type of software agent, with the feature of autonomy, social ability, learning, and most significantly, mobility more specifically, a mobile agent is a process that can transport its state from one environment to another, with its data intact, and be capable of performing appropriately in the new environment. Mobile computing seminar pdf report and ppt why go. In this article mobile agents will be addressed as tools for mobile computing. Reasons are the inefficiencies associated with more. This mobility greatly enhances the productivity of each computing element in the network and creates a powerful computing environment.

A mobile agentbased approach to webbased distributed. Set is expected to give buyers and sellers the necessary confidence to launch. An agent based optimization framework for mobile cloud computing angin, and bhargava figure 1. An agentbased optimization framework for mobilecloud computing. Mobile agentsthe new paradigm in computing home pages. We investigated new system software architectures that support mobile code, based on network and distributed computing. To accomplish its task, the mobile agent can transport itself to. Here you can download the free lecture notes of mobile computing pdf notes mc notes pdf materials with multiple file links to download. Mobile agent is a selfcontained and identifiable computer program that can.

Organization and mobility in mobile agent computing ichiro satoh national institute of informatics 212 hitotsubashi, chiyodaku, tokyo 1018430, japan email. An approach for mobile agent security and fault tolerance. Due to the wide usage of mobile devices and variety of applications, mobile cloud computing becomes a necessary part for mobile devices, due to. An overview of mobile agents in mobile computing cse 6345. You can design 2d and 3d floor plans, add plots, gardens and compass, calculate square footage and you can also add watermarks with your company logos. Although there are advantages and disadvantages of using mobile agents 8 in a particular scenario, their successful applications range. Edu notes computer science resources mobile computing. Abstract mobile agent technology has been promoted as an emerging technology that makes it much easier to design, implement, and. Mobile agent computing paradigm for building a flexible structural health monitoring sensor network bo chen. Threat agent can enable mdm system to act wrongly in case of natural. A mobile agent is a program that, once it is launched by a user, can travel from node to node autonomously, and can continue to function even if the user is disconnected. Mobile agent ma technology can be used for managing, transporting and communicating functional components in a broader network infrastructure.

Security is an important issue for the widespread deployment of applications based on software agent technology. With mobile agent middleware, a sensor network is able to adopt newly developed diagnosis algorithms and make adjustment in response to operational or task changes. The emergence of agent based systems is signalling the beginning of one of the most important paradigm shifts in computing since object oriented. A deep reinforcement learning approach zhao chen, member, ieee and xiaodong wang, fellow, ieee abstract mobile edge computing mec emerges recently as a promising solution to relieve resourcelimited. Mobile computing and its advantages, disadvantages and. All these agents are executed on top of the uwagents mobile agent execution platform which we have developed with java as an infrastructure for agent based grid computing. An overview of mobile agents in mobile computing cse6345. Aug 12, 2010 the mobile agent middleware is built on a mobile agent system called mobile. This page contains mobile computing seminar and ppt with pdf report. Pdf mobile agent paradigm is an emerging and exciting paradigm for mobile computing applications. Consistent database for all agents print on local printer or other service how do we find it. Mobile agents provides a practical introduction to mobile agent technology and surveys the state of the art in mobile agent research. Mobile agents have been introduced as a key enabler for distributed computing.

Mobile computing mobile computing vs wireless networking mobile computing applications characteristics of mobile computing structure of mobile computing application. However, since a mobile agent itself can carry its information to another computer, we can only write a single program to define distributed computing. Mobile agent computing paradigm for building a flexible. A mobile agent based computing model for enhancing. An agent based secure intemet payment system for mobile computing 81 under the set protocol is clearly much more secure than doing it, say, in a restaurant, where the card is normally taken away from the customers eyes.

All registration messages between a mobile node and home agent are required to contain the mobile home authentication extension mhae. This allows processes to migrate from computer to computer, for processes to split into multiple instances that execute on different machines, and to return to their point of origin. A ma integrates application logic and has the unique ability to autonomously transport. Jul 28, 2016 mobile cloud computing mcc is a new technology for mobile web services. Mobile agent technology has been promoted as an emerging technology that makes it much easier to design, implement, and maintain distributed systems, including cloud comput ingandsensornetworks. This text introduces the concepts and principles of mobile agents, provides an overview of mobile agent technology, and focuses on applications in networking and distributed computing. Pdf the case for mobileagent computing for defense. Keywords cloud, mobile agents, mobile clients 1 introduction cloud computing presents a new way to.

Mobile transportable agents an agent is an independent software program, which runs on behalf of a network user. Mobile computing pdf notes mc notes pdf smartzworld. One important aspect to note about the recent use of mobile computing is the increased access to social networking services from mobile devices. Computing federation, the architecture of maboccf mobile agent based open cloud computing federation is shown in fig 1. Mobile agents for pervasive computing using a novel method of message passing david levine, renjith thomas, farhad kamangar, and gergely v. This paper gives a brief introduction to mobile agents and their suitability in mobile computing environment. An agentbased secure internet payment system for mobile. Jan 17, 2019 this feature is not available right now. On computing mobile agent routes for data fusion in distributed sensor networks. Reasons are the inefficiencies associated with more traditionally distributed. Michael friedrich, kirsten terfloth, gerd nusser, and wolfgang kuchlin wsi for computer. This work also analyses the possibilities of amalgamating mobile agents in cloud computing, since both these technologies are promising and commercially useful thus the idea is to resolve.

Pdf with the recent surge in internet based users, the idea of mobile agent based computing systems has gained popularity. Mobile computing technology applications and service creation authors aske k. The mobile computer can change its location to a foreign network and still access and communicate with and through the mobile computers home network. The mobile agent is a program that allows you to create quality floor plans to sell to estate agents. Role of mobile agents in mobile computing environment. The mobile agent middleware is built on a mobile agent system called mobile. Pdf on computing mobile agent routes for data fusion in. Such action on behalf of implies the authority to decide which, if any, action is appropriate. Organization and mobility in mobile agent computing. Jul 07, 2016 for the love of physics walter lewin may 16, 2011 duration. In this regard, we have tried to propose a new mobile medical web service system. Unlike most mobile agent systems, which are used only for job deployment and result collection in grid computing, uwagents addresses speci. With the recent surge in internet based users, the idea of mobile agent based computing systems has gained popularity.

Mac protocols wireless mac issues fixed assignment schemes random assignment schemes reservation. Future mobile cloud computing mcc should be considered as a new service model where mobile agents and related resources collectively operate as mobile clouds that support and utilize efficient and effective computation, storage and networking capabilities, contextcontent awareness, content discovery, data collection and dissemination. Tran, student member, ieee, abolfazl hajisami, student member, ieee, parul pandey, student member, ieee, and dario pompili, senior member, ieee abstractmobile edge computing mec is an emerging. Computing with mobile agents in distributed networks to merge upon meeting sometimes referred to as sticky agents or whether or not they can send selfgenerated messages. The solaris implementation of mobile ip supports only ipv4. Mobile computing i about the tutorial mobile computing is a technology that allows transmission of data, voice and video via a computer or any other wireless enabled device without having to be connected to a fixed physical link. Mobile agents process migration and its implications. Mobile agent technology offers several potential benefits over conventional clientserver computing that could help improve classic distributed system designs. Computing with mobile agents in distributed networks. Handbook of wireless networks and mobile computing. Subject computer subject headings mobile computing wireless communication systems. Physical entities are computers that change locations logical entities are instances of a running user application or a mobile agent. Talukder author roopa r yavagal author publication data new delhi. This tutorial will give an overview of mobile computing and then it will take you through how it evolved and.

Collaborative mobile edge computing in 5g networks. Pdf a new paradigm for mobile agent computing researchgate. Mobile agents mobile computing tutorial minigranth. Mobile computing seminar pdf report and ppt study mafia. Mobile agents in networking and distributed computing wiley. Mobile transportable agents an agent is an independent software. Mobile agents are an effective paradigm for distributed applications, and are particularly attractive in a dynamic network environment involving intermittently connected devices. Helal, optimizing thin clients for wireless computing via localization of keyboard activities, proceedings of the international performance, computing, and communication conference ipccc, phoenix, arizona, april 2001. The use of mobile agents is becoming increasingly popular when computing in networked environments, ranging from internet to the data grid, both as a theoretical computational paradigm and as a systemsupported programming platform in networked systems that support autonomous mobile agents, the main theoretical concern is how to develop efficient agent based system protocols. Introduction in mobile wireless computing, most of the assumptions that in. The images and content in this post belong to their respective owners.

A mobile agent is a specific form of mobile code, within the field of code mobility. Mobile agents are agents that can physically travel across a network, and perform tasks on machines that provide agent hosting capability. Tata mcgrawhill publishing company publication date 2006 edition na physical description xxiv, 668 p. The integrity of the registration messages is protected by a preshared 128bit key between a mobile node and home agent. Sumit thakur cse seminars mobile computing seminar and ppt with pdf report. There is a tradeoff between location update effort when an agent moves and agent. An agentbased optimization framework for mobilecloud. Mobile computing is a technology that allows transmission of data, voice and video via a computer or any other wireless enabled device without having to be connected to a fixed physical link. Mobile agent system requirements and design forces. While hardware has been improving at a rapid rate such that these demands may eventually be met, system software is still an. Advantages of mobile computing this is a yourstory community post, written by one of our readers. Then, if the agent possesses necessary authentication credentials, its executable parts are started. Abstract defense computing applications are often highly demanding in terms of performance, reliability and security.

Pdf a mobile agent framework for followme applications. A mobile agent is specialized in that in addition to being an independent program executing on behalf of a network user, it can travel to multiple locations in the network. Wattenhofer 121 mobile devices performance and size pager receive only tiny. Mobile computing notes pdf mc pdf notes book starts with the topics the rapidly expanding technology of cellular communication, wireless lans, and satellite services will make information accessible anywhere and at any time. Mobile agent, namely, is a type of software agent, with the feature of autonomy, social ability, learning, and most important, mobility.

To this end, we implement a medical cloud multi agent system mcmas. Mobile agents for pervasive computing using a novel method. Uwagents is a javabased mobile agent system optimized for implementing grid computing infrastructure. The mobile agent middleware allows a sensor network moving computational programs to the data source. Importance of wireless freedom of movement no loss of connectivity increase in productivity cellular network organization use multiple lowpower transmitters 100 w or less areas divided into cells eac. Mobile computing about both physical and logical computing entities that move. Students and researchers can use the book as an introduction to the concepts and possibilities of this field and as an overview of ongoing research. In particular, although full mobile agent systems involve all the same research issues and more as more restricted mobile code systems, researchers must be careful to demonstrate that the switch to mobile agents can be made incrementally.

Mobile agents are inherently distributed in nature. Mobile agent technology offers several potential benefits over conventional client server computing that could help improve classic distributed system designs. Application to services in mobile computing and architectural improvements vasileios a. An approach for mobile agent security and fault tolerance using distributed transactions email as a transport medium there are no mechanisms.

60 887 881 1308 698 50 544 238 433 567 691 27 843 1098 575 161 663 1203 454 1333 1495 716 481 610 706 7 502 729 1433 22 512 493 288 106 1171 124 128 672